Navigating the O Visa – A Gateway for Extraordinary Talents to the U.S.

The O visa category is a non-immigrant temporary worker visa granted to individuals who possess extraordinary ability in the sciences, arts, education, business, or athletics, or who have a demonstrated record of extraordinary achievement in the motion picture or television industry. Understanding Temporary Protected Status (TPS): Eligibility and Benefits

Temporary Protected Status (TPS) is a vital humanitarian program that allows individuals from designated countries to live and work in the United States when returning to their home country is unsafe.
